Web数据挖掘主要是通过对网页数据进行收集、处理和分析,以发现有价值的信息和模式,应用于商业决策、用户行为分析、搜索引擎优化等方面。 其中一个重要的应用领域是用户行为分析,通过分析用户在网站上的行为数据,如点击、浏览时间、搜索关键词等,可以深入了解用户的兴趣和需求,为网站优化提供数据支持。例如,通过识别高跳出率的页面,可以及时调整内容和设计,提升用户体验和转化率。
一、WEB数据挖掘的基本概念
Web数据挖掘的核心在于从互联网数据中提取有用的信息和知识。这包括结构化数据、半结构化数据和非结构化数据。结构化数据通常存储在数据库中,具有明确的格式,如用户注册信息和交易记录。半结构化数据包括XML和JSON格式的数据,虽然有一定的结构,但不如数据库中的数据那样严格。非结构化数据则包括文本、图像、视频等,数据没有固定的结构。
Web数据挖掘技术主要包括信息检索、数据预处理、数据挖掘算法和结果解释。信息检索是从大量网页中提取相关数据的过程,涉及网页抓取、文本提取和索引创建。数据预处理则包括数据清洗、数据集成和数据转换等步骤,目的是提高数据质量。数据挖掘算法则有分类、聚类、关联规则、回归分析等多种方法,用于发现数据中的模式和关系。最后,结果解释是将挖掘出的知识转化为可执行的商业策略或行动方案。
二、WEB数据挖掘的应用领域
Web数据挖掘在多个领域有广泛应用,电子商务、社交媒体、搜索引擎和网络安全是其中的几个典型例子。在电子商务中,数据挖掘用于分析用户购买行为,推荐产品,优化供应链管理等。通过分析用户的浏览和购买记录,可以提供个性化推荐,提升用户满意度和销售额。
在社交媒体中,数据挖掘用于分析用户的社交网络、情感倾向和话题趋势等。通过分析用户发布的内容和互动行为,可以洞察用户的兴趣和情感变化,为广告投放和内容策划提供数据支持。在搜索引擎中,数据挖掘用于优化搜索算法,提高搜索结果的相关性和准确性。通过分析用户的搜索行为和点击数据,可以不断改进搜索引擎的性能和用户体验。
在网络安全领域,数据挖掘用于检测网络攻击、识别恶意软件和保护用户隐私。通过分析网络流量和用户行为数据,可以及时发现异常和潜在威胁,提高网络安全防护能力。
三、WEB数据挖掘的技术方法
Web数据挖掘涉及多种技术方法,文本挖掘、链接分析、使用者行为分析和社交网络分析是其中的几个主要方法。文本挖掘是从网页内容中提取有价值信息的过程,涉及自然语言处理、关键词提取、情感分析等技术。链接分析则是分析网页之间的链接关系,用于评估网页的权威性和重要性,PageRank算法是其中的经典例子。
使用者行为分析是通过分析用户在网站上的行为数据,如点击、浏览时间、页面停留时间等,来了解用户的兴趣和需求。通过构建用户画像,可以提供个性化服务和推荐,提升用户体验。社交网络分析则是分析社交媒体上的用户关系和互动行为,识别关键人物和社交群体,洞察话题传播和影响力。
数据挖掘算法是Web数据挖掘的核心,包括分类、聚类、关联规则、回归分析和序列模式挖掘等。分类算法用于将数据分类到不同的类别中,常用的有决策树、朴素贝叶斯和支持向量机等。聚类算法用于将相似的数据聚集到同一个簇中,常用的有K-means、层次聚类和DBSCAN等。关联规则用于发现数据中的关联关系,如购物篮分析中常用的Apriori算法。回归分析用于预测数据的连续值,如销量预测中的线性回归和多项式回归。序列模式挖掘用于发现数据中的时间序列模式,如用户行为路径分析中的FP-Growth算法。
四、WEB数据挖掘的挑战与未来发展
Web数据挖掘面临多种挑战,包括数据隐私、安全性、数据质量和计算效率等。数据隐私是一个重要问题,随着数据隐私法规的不断出台和用户隐私意识的提高,如何在保护用户隐私的前提下进行数据挖掘成为一个难题。安全性问题则涉及如何防止数据泄露和网络攻击,保障数据和系统的安全。数据质量是影响数据挖掘结果准确性的关键因素,如何处理缺失值、噪声和重复数据,提高数据质量是一个重要的研究方向。计算效率则是指如何在处理海量数据时提高算法的运行效率和可扩展性,分布式计算和大数据技术是解决这一问题的有效途径。
未来,随着人工智能、机器学习和深度学习技术的不断发展,Web数据挖掘将迎来新的机遇。人工智能和机器学习技术可以提高数据挖掘算法的智能化水平和预测能力,深度学习技术则可以处理更加复杂和高维度的数据,提高挖掘结果的准确性和鲁棒性。此外,随着物联网和大数据技术的发展,Web数据挖掘的应用范围将进一步扩大,数据来源将更加多样化和海量化,这将为数据挖掘技术的发展提供新的动力。
在实际应用中,Web数据挖掘需要与业务需求紧密结合,通过不断优化数据挖掘流程和方法,提高数据挖掘的实际效果和商业价值。例如,在电子商务中,可以通过A/B测试和用户反馈,不断优化推荐算法和用户体验。在社交媒体中,可以通过实时监测和分析社交数据,及时发现和响应用户的情感变化和话题趋势。在网络安全中,可以通过持续监测和分析网络流量,及时发现和应对潜在的安全威胁。
总的来说,Web数据挖掘是一项具有广泛应用前景的技术,随着技术的发展和应用的深入,其在各个领域的价值将不断显现。通过不断探索和创新,Web数据挖掘将为互联网时代的数据驱动决策和智能化服务提供强有力的支持。
相关问答FAQs:
1. 什么是Web数据挖掘,它的主要目标是什么?
Web数据挖掘是一种从互联网上收集、分析和提取有价值信息的过程。它结合了数据挖掘技术和Web技术,以帮助组织和个人发现隐藏在海量数据中的模式和趋势。主要目标包括:识别用户行为和偏好、提升搜索引擎的效果、优化网站内容、增强用户体验以及预测市场趋势。通过对网页、社交媒体、论坛和其他在线数据源进行分析,Web数据挖掘能够为企业提供决策支持,帮助其更好地满足客户需求和增强市场竞争力。
2. Web数据挖掘的常用技术和方法有哪些?
在Web数据挖掘中,常用的技术和方法包括网页爬虫、数据清洗、数据集成、模式识别、机器学习和自然语言处理等。网页爬虫用于自动访问和下载网页内容,数据清洗则是去除噪声和冗余信息,确保数据的质量。数据集成将来自不同来源的数据进行合并,以便于后续分析。模式识别和机器学习技术则用于识别数据中的潜在模式,而自然语言处理可以帮助分析文本数据,提取关键信息。通过这些技术的结合应用,Web数据挖掘能够有效地转化为有意义的洞察和结论。
3. Web数据挖掘在商业领域的应用有哪些?
Web数据挖掘在商业领域的应用非常广泛,涵盖市场分析、客户关系管理、产品推荐和竞争对手分析等方面。通过分析用户在网站上的行为数据,企业可以了解客户的购买习惯和偏好,从而制定更加精准的营销策略。此外,Web数据挖掘还可以用于社交媒体分析,帮助企业监测品牌声誉,识别潜在客户,并及时响应市场变化。在产品推荐方面,基于用户的历史行为和喜好,企业可以利用推荐系统为客户提供个性化的产品建议,提高客户满意度和销售转化率。通过这些应用,Web数据挖掘为企业提供了更深层次的市场洞察与决策支持。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。